Our combined Law and Sociology (BA) program is designed to enhance your knowledge of legal principles and practices, along with sociological concepts, research methodologies, and societal issues.
This dual-degree program seeks to deepen your comprehension of legal frameworks, sociological perspectives, and the interplay between social structures and institutions.
You'll cultivate a critical understanding of law's societal role while acquiring both contextual and professional legal insights. This approach enables you to recognize legal systems and processes as fundamental components of social organization.
In sociology studies, you'll investigate crucial contemporary social issues, potentially covering areas like criminal justice systems, gender studies, media influences, racial dynamics, and global economic structures.

Qualification Requirements

A levels
A level typical offer
AAB.

A level additional information
You will also need grade 4/C in GCSE Mathematics and grade 6/B in GCSE English Language. Applicants with grade 6/B in GCSE English Literature and minimum grade 4/C in GCSE English Language may also be considered.

A level contextual offer
We welcome applications from candidates who meet the contextual eligibility criteria and whose predicted grades are close to, or slightly below, the contextual offer level. The typical contextual offer is ABB. See if you're eligible.

General GCSE requirements
Unless specified differently above, you will also need a minimum of GCSE grade 4 or C (or an equivalent qualification) in English Language and either Mathematics or a Science subject. IB
IB typical offer
34.

IB additional information
You will also need grade 6/B in GCSE English Language or International Baccalaureate grade 5 in English A (Higher or Standard Level), grade 5 in Higher Level English B or grade 6 in Standard Level English B. Applicants with grade 6/B in GCSE English Literature and minimum grade 4/C in GCSE English Language may also be considered.

IB contextual offer
We welcome applications from candidates who meet the contextual eligibility criteria and whose predicted grades are close to, or slightly below, the contextual offer level. The typical contextual offer is 32. See if you're eligible.

General GCSE requirements
Unless specified differently above, you will also need a minimum of GCSE grade 4 or C (or an equivalent qualification) in English Language and either Mathematics or a Science subject.
